Company Overview:

The Asset Protection Security Officer is responsible for safeguarding company assets by preventing theft, fraud, and other financial losses, while ensuring adherence to safety and environmental standards at one or multiple store locations. This role is vital in creating a secure and safe environment for both customers and associates.

Role and Responsibilities:

As an Asset Protection Security Officer, you will identify potential risks, implement security procedures, and support operational and safety objectives within the store.

  • Detect and manage incidents of theft, fraud, or other security issues to prevent financial losses.
  • Monitor store activities through CCTV footage and exception reports.
  • Audit physical security measures and the Electronic Article Surveillance (EAS) system.
  • Promote a culture of shrink reduction and asset protection throughout the store.
  • Prepare detailed and accurate case reports documenting recoveries and apprehensions.
  • Preserve evidence and coordinate with law enforcement as necessary.
  • Provide testimony in civil or criminal court proceedings when required.
  • Report unsafe or hazardous conditions promptly to the Manager on Duty.
  • Perform all responsibilities while minimizing risks to associates, customers, vendors, and the company.
  • Act with integrity and address asset protection and operational concerns raised by associates.
  • Support store goals while carrying out essential asset protection and operational duties.
